    Review by Starwraith169 in course Lions Park

    3.00 star(s) Pretty Decent Course The course is set in a well maintained city park with bathrooms and other emenities. The designer made good use of the land he was given to use. There is a good mix of long/short shots, concrete teepads, and 2 bridges that were made for teepads. There is a creek thats in...

  8. Lions Park 1710 mi (from your location) Grangeville, ID
    3.173 reviews
    Holes / Baskets: 18 / 18
    Length: 4500 ft
    Hole Type: DISCatcher
    Tee Type: Concrete
    Course Type: Permanent course
    Landscape: Moderately Hilly
    Terrain: Lightly Wooded
    Multiple Tees / Pins: No / No
